Output 63e40598dbb932d6cded6af843d0713ac5290d4dd1905bdb63ac40e0608c00c5:52

value
147472
script pubkey
OP_0 OP_PUSHBYTES_32 1a3e0d28b7a20aae838ff6ae04be965f1ae5c174c38f5bca87af18c5e9c4808c
address
bc1qrglq629h5g92aqu076hqf05ktudwtst5cw84hj584uvvt6wyszxq7s9uh3
transaction
63e40598dbb932d6cded6af843d0713ac5290d4dd1905bdb63ac40e0608c00c5
spent
true